Child Custody Laws in Colorado
Colorado uses specific terms for custody and focuses on several important factors when determining parenting arrangements. Every custody case is unique.
Courts evaluate how parenting time supports the child’s stability and well-being.
Courts consider how parents will make important decisions regarding education, healthcare, and other major issues.
The child’s relationship with each parent is an important factor in custody decisions.
Maintaining consistency in the child’s home, school, and daily routine can be important.
Courts consider the emotional, physical, and developmental needs of the child.

Parenting Plans in Colorado
A strong parenting plan should address the key aspects of your child's daily life and future. Clear agreements help reduce misunderstandings and future disputes.
Modifying Child Custody Orders
Custody and parenting orders may be modified when circumstances substantially change. We help parents pursue modifications when necessary to protect their child's best interests.
Child Custody and Douglas County Courts
Many custody matters involving Highlands Ranch residents are handled through the Douglas County District Court. Understanding local procedures and expectations can help parents navigate the process more effectively and reduce unnecessary stress.
